This course provides a basic introduction to Lacan's writings.
We will be reading Ecrits: A Selection; a little bit of Kristeva, who will have to bear the burden of representing "French feminism"; and some "post-Lacanian" material, including Willy Apollon's After Lacan and some of Tim Dean's recent work on sexuality. Seminar presentation, seminar paper. |
